Market Overview
The United States Clinical Trial Supplies Market was valued at USD 446.06 million in 2024 and is projected to reach USD 638.33 million by 2030, growing at a CAGR of 6.13% during the forecast period. Growth in the market is fueled by the rising complexity of clinical trials, particularly with the advent of personalized medicine and biologics, requiring specialized handling, storage, and distribution solutions. Demand for advanced supply chain models, including temperature-sensitive logistics and just-in-time delivery, is on the rise. The expansion of decentralized clinical trials (DCTs) further adds to logistical challenges, prompting companies to invest in digital technologies such as IoT and AI to optimize supply chain operations. While market opportunities abound, challenges persist with increasing supply chain complexity, regulatory compliance costs, and economic disruptions like inflation and raw material price fluctuations. Nonetheless, the integration of digital solutions, the expansion of clinical trial sites, and the growing focus on patient-centric models are poised to create new growth avenues for the market.
Key Market Drivers
Rising Number of Clinical Trials Across Therapeutic Areas
The steady rise in clinical trials across a broad range of therapeutic areas is a key driver of the United States Clinical Trial Supplies Market. Pharmaceutical, biotechnology, and medical device companies are significantly expanding their research and development efforts, fueled by increasing investment in innovation and the growing burden of chronic diseases such as cancer, diabetes, and cardiovascular disorders. As new therapies progress into clinical stages, there is an escalating need for efficient and specialized supply chains to support complex trial protocols, manage temperature-sensitive products, and ensure reliable delivery to global sites. Data from the World Health Organization's ICTRP highlights consistent growth in newly recruiting clinical trials across most regions, with particular momentum in South-East Asia. The rising complexity of decentralized trials and direct-to-patient models further intensifies the demand for agile and innovative supply chain strategies. As sponsors diversify therapeutic pipelines and broaden geographic footprints, clinical trial supply providers are becoming increasingly critical to ensuring the success and regulatory compliance of trials, supporting the market's expansion.
Key Market Challenges
Complexity in Managing Global Supply Chains
Managing global supply chains remains a significant hurdle for the United States Clinical Trial Supplies Market. Expanding clinical trials across multiple countries introduces operational complexities, including navigating diverse customs regulations, language requirements, and varying local timelines. Demand forecasting becomes increasingly difficult due to unpredictable patient enrollment and protocol amendments, straining inventory management. Maintaining drug stability, timely delivery, and compliance becomes even more critical for temperature-sensitive biologics and advanced therapies, often requiring costly specialized logistics. The rise of decentralized trials necessitates flexible supply models while maintaining rigorous quality standards. Adapting supply chains through the use of advanced technology and building resilient infrastructure significantly increases operational costs, putting pressure on clinical trial budgets and profitability.
Key Market Trends
Increased Adoption of Supply Chain Digitalization and Real-Time Monitoring
The adoption of supply chain digitalization and real-time monitoring is reshaping operations within the United States Clinical Trial Supplies Market. Companies are increasingly implementing digital platforms like Interactive Response Technology (IRT), cloud-based inventory systems, and IoT-enabled tracking devices to improve supply chain transparency and responsiveness. Real-time visibility into shipment progress, drug availability, and temperature control allows supply managers to proactively address potential issues, minimizing stockouts, wastage, and delays. Real-time monitoring also ensures regulatory compliance by recording key data such as temperature excursions and chain-of-custody, crucial for high-value biologics and personalized therapies. Predictive analytics further support smarter resupply strategies, optimizing trial continuity and improving patient experience. These digital advancements offer enhanced operational control, reduced risks, and improved efficiency for sponsors and supply chain partners alike.
